Predictions, by irradiance data, of energy productivity of large scale grid-connected photovoltaic plants with sun-tracking systems

keywords ELECTRICAL MEASUREMENTS, NUMERICAL SIMULATION

Reference persons MARCO BADAMI, FILIPPO SPERTINO

Thesis type THEORETICAL AND EXPERIMENTAL

Description The student will set up a mathematical model to compute the power profiles generated by grid-connected photovoltaic plants equipped with sun-trackers. Then, she/he will compare the predicted productivity with the measured energy produced by the PV plants in order to define predictive maintenance activities which permit to optimize the enegy production and the economic revenues.

Required skills solar photovoltaic systems course
